REM Conference 2025

The annual Renewable Energy Markets™— or REM™—conference, held in Houston on September 3–5, convenes a broad spectrum of industry professionals who are rapidly transforming the global clean energy marketplace. For 30 years, the REM™ conference has remained the leading event for promoting and accelerating the clean energy economy.

The REM™ conference brings corporate leaders, policymakers, and suppliers together to collaborate and guide the rapidly expanding market. Attendees explore emerging trends in policy, exchange best practices in renewable energy procurement and marketing, review the latest technology and market innovations, and help shape the future for renewable energy.

What's Possible

Climate Resolve, Estolano Advisors, and Better World Group cordially invite you to What’s Possible on Thursday, May 22.

Building on themes from the Federal Reserve Bank of New York’s recently-published book, What’s Possible: Investing NOW for Prosperous, Sustainable Neighborhoods, the conference will highlight ways investment can support resilience and community development.

The aim? To identify roadblocks in obtaining capital for climate resilience projects – and how various sources of capital can support community-led adaptation.
